
Stealth Announce 2007 TV Schedule
December 28, 2006 - National Lacrosse League (NLL)
San Jose Stealth News Release
(San Jose, CA, December 28, 2006) --- The San Jose Stealth have announced their two game television schedule for the 2007 Season. The schedule includes the January 5 Stealth Home Opener against the Rochester Knighthawks aired on FSN Bay Area and the March 24 match-up against the Portland LumberJax at Portland aired on Versus.
FSN Bay Area will broadcast the Home Opener live at 7:30 p.m. with Dan Rusanowsky calling the play by play for the Stealth. Dan will be joined by a Stealth scratched player for the color commentary. Stealth radio announcer Rocky Koplik will offer commentary on KLIV 1590 AM.
The March 24 game at Portland will be broadcast by VERSUS at 7:00 p.m.

The Stealth will debut their latest acquisition, Colin Doyle on opening night at HP Pavilion. Likened to the 'Joe Thornton' of lacrosse by Stealth G.M. Johnny Mouradian, Doyle's resume includes 2005 NLL MVP, three-time playoff MVP (1999, 2002 and 2005), and five-time NLL champion. Between 1998 and 2006 Doyle scored 297 goals and 388 assists ranking him sixth in all-time scoring and fifth in all-time assists in the NLL.
